2025-08-04 04:56:05
在数字经济迅猛发展的今天,区块链技术正以其独特优势在各行各业中展露头角。随之而来的是市场对区块链应用程序(APP)的需求不断上升,许多开发者和企业对如何选择合适的区块链APP制作软件感到困惑。在众多选择中,究竟哪些软件能够满足用户需求、提供高效便捷的开发体验?本文将详细探讨市场上最优秀的区块链APP制作软件,以帮助你在快速变化的技术环境中做出明智的选择。
在深入选择制作软件之前,首先要了解区块链技术的基础知识。区块链是一种去中心化的分布式账本技术,其核心特点包括透明性、不可篡改性及安全性。这些特性使得区块链在金融、供应链、医疗、公共服务等领域展现出极大的应用潜力。例如,通过区块链技术,用户可以实现点对点的价值传输,降低中介费用,提高交易的效率和安全性。
随着区块链技术的推广,越来越多的开发工具和平台应运而生。以下是一些在行业内得到普遍认可的APP制作软件,各有其优缺点。
Ethereum是一个开放源代码的区块链平台,支持智能合约的创建。很多开发者倾向于使用Ethereum,因为它已经建立了一个庞大的生态系统,拥有丰富的文档和社区支持。
优点:智能合约功能强大,安全性高,社区活跃。
缺点:相对较高的交易费用,节点需要较高的技术门槛进行搭建。
作为一个模块化的开源区块链框架,Hyperledger Fabric特别适用于企业级解决方案。其隐私功能和灵活的共识机制,使其在企业间的交易中备受青睐。
优点:支持多组织协作,隐私性强,灵活的架构。
缺点:学习曲线较陡,开发复杂度高。
Binance Smart Chain(BSC)为开发者提供了一个高性能、多链兼容的环境,因其低交易费用和较快的处理速度而受到青睐。
优点:费用低廉,速度快,与Ethereum兼容。
缺点:相对Ethereum生态系统较小,但正在快速成长。
Algorand通过其独特的Pure Proof-of-Stake共识机制,实现了一种快速且安全的区块链体验,适合高频率交易的应用。
优点:交易速度快,权益证明机制高效。
缺点:目前生态系统尚在发展,工具和资源较其他平台少。
Cardano注重研究和科学方法,通过分层架构提供高质量的智能合约开发平台,适用于不同类型的应用。
优点:研究背景扎实,安全性高,先见之明的设计理念。
缺点:更新周期长,主网升级过程较难。
在选择区块链APP制作软件时,有几个重要的考虑因素:
不同软件的学习曲线差异较大。初学者应优先选择界面友好、文档详尽的工具。而有经验的开发者则可以选择更灵活、高度可定制的平台。
区块链开发往往涉及高昂的交易费用和服务器维护成本,选择时需要考虑到长期的运营支出,确保预算的合理分配。
完善的社区和丰富的文档可以为开发者提供必要的支持。强大的社区意味着更少的故障时间和更快的问题解决速度。
不同的软件提供的功能差异会影响最终的应用效果,比如智能合约、身份验证、交易确认等,所有功能应符合项目需求。
随着区块链技术的不断演进,我们可以预见未来将出现更多高效、易用的APP制作软件。这些新工具将可能整合人工智能与区块链技术,使应用开发的自动化程度更高。同时,随着去中心化金融(DeFi)和非同质化代币(NFT)等新兴领域的兴起,相关工具也将不断演变,以满足新的市场需求。
选择一款合适的区块链APP制作软件可以显著提升项目开发的效率和质量。通过对当前流行的软件进行深入分析,并结合自身团队的实际需求,开发者们可以找到最适合自己的工具,在快速变化的区块链时代中把握机遇。
无论是初学者还是经验丰富的开发者,都应不断学习和适应新技术,以便在区块链的广阔天地中继续前行。
本文内容旨在为想要入门或进阶区块链APP开发的开发者提供全面的信息与建议,希望你能够在这个复杂而快速发展的领域中找到属于自己的定位!